G83990 G8 Ruling Active

The tariff classification of a handbag from China.

Issued November 9, 2000 by U.S. Customs and Border Protection.

Tariff classification

HTS codes: 4202.22.1500

Headings: 4202

Product description

The item is a ladies handbag designed to be worn as a backpack to carry money, keys and small accessories. It is manufactured of clear polyvinyl chloride (PVC) sheeting. The interior features a single compartment with no additional features. The front exterior of the bag features a full-width zippered pocket to contain other small personal effects. The top of the bag is secured by means of a drawstring with a cord lock fastener, in addition to a flap with a hook and loop fastener. The bag measures approximately 8”(W) x 7”(H) with a 4” base.

CBP rationale

The applicable subheading for the handbag will be 4202.22.1500,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TS), which provides for handbags, whether or not with shoulder strap, including those without handle, with outer surface of sheeting of plastic.

The applicable subheading for the handbag will be 4202.22.1500,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TS), which provides for handbags, whether or not with shoulder strap, including those without handle, with outer surface of sheeting of plastic. The rate of duty will be 17.6 percent ad valorem. There are no antidumping or countervailing duties on handbags from China at this time.
